Re: Ramsey, Brunell - Arms race

I was just going to post something about their performances...

Basically this is what I think it comes down to:

Would I want Brunell starting even though he's shown that he's not the has-been we thought he was last year? No. And the reason behind this is that I believe Ramsey will continue to develop throughout this preseason and become a much more efficient quarterback. Granted, he had two interceptions, and I think that is Ramsey's only fault right now, his decision making. Sure, he under and overthrew a couple balls on Friday night but there aren't many QBs who can routinely hit those passes with every throw.

His deep outs to Patten were amazing and he made the majority of those throws. Also, take away the fact that there was no Cooley, no Portis and we ran a LOT of pass plays and there you have it. I think that Ramsey showed a lot of promise minus those two INTs. I LOVED the fact that we were willing to throw downfield AND he looked much more comfortable in the pocket.
